How New Jersey State Police Pay and Benefits Actually Work
The compensation for state troopers is structured and multifaceted, going beyond just the base salary. Officers are placed on a specific pay scale that rewards experience, education, and longevity. Understanding how do New Jersey State Police officers get paid involves looking at several key components:
Base Salary: This is the foundation of income and is determined by rank and years of service. New hires enter at a designated level and receive scheduled increases as they progress through training and on-the-job experience.
Overtime and Details: Troopers often work beyond regular shifts, which can significantly boost earnings. Details for private events or specific state assignments provide another avenue for additional pay.

Benefits Package: A robust benefits package is a major part of the total compensation. This typically includes comprehensive health insurance, retirement plans, paid time off, and sometimes tuition reimbursement for officers pursuing further education.
For example, a recruit might start at a certain scale but could see their annual earnings increase substantially after a few years with raises and overtime. It is important to note that all compensation is governed by state regulations and union agreements, ensuring consistency and fairness across the force.

Opportunities and Realistic Considerations of This Career
Choosing a career as a state trooper comes with distinct advantages and challenges. On the positive side, the role offers job stability, a strong sense of duty, and the potential for a comfortable living through pay and benefits. The training and work environment build discipline and resilience. However, it is crucial to have realistic expectations. The job requires long hours, including nights, weekends, and holidays. It can be physically and mentally demanding, requiring quick thinking and composure in high-pressure situations. Success in this field depends on a genuine commitment to public service and the ability to meet strict physical and ethical standards.
